But I seem to have found a solution. post-auth { Post-Auth-Type REJECT { reply_log } } I added that and started getting the expected log entries for reject. It's not entirely obvious that the main reply_log entry in post-auth wouldn't be universal (e.g. success AND failure) but apparently it's not -Dan Mullen
